A button has a property "Cancel", setting it to True means "If someone use
the Esc key, while for form owns the keyboard, generates the onClick event
for that button". The property "Default" does the same about the Enter key.

So, make a button that will close the form, set its property Cancel to True
(or Yes, if from the form designer).
